India Post Payments Bank (IPPB), established under the Ministry of Communication and the Department of Post, is one of the Indian Government’s significant initiatives. With an extensive network of Indian post offices, IPPB provides banking services similar to those of major national banks. Every account holder is given a unique IPPB Customer ID, ensuring secure and personalised banking.
This guide will help you understand how to find your IPPB Customer ID and efficiently manage your account.
A unique Customer ID is generated when you open a savings account with IPPB. IPPB provides doorstep services for account opening, allowing you to choose between a basic, regular, or premium savings account. These accounts can be opened at designated access points or through the doorstep service.
After creating your account, you receive an account number and a 10-digit Customer ID (CIF). It is advisable to keep this information secure. However, if you misplace your Customer ID, there are several ways to retrieve it.
When you open an account, you receive a card containing a QR code and instructions on using your IPPB digital account. By scanning this QR code and authenticating via OTP or OVD, you can access complete account details, including your account number and Customer ID.

Most post offices function as IPPB access points and dedicated centres for customer convenience. By verifying your account details, you can visit these locations and obtain your Customer ID in IPPB.
You can download the mini statement online to find your IPPB Customer ID from your monthly account statement. If you are using mobile banking, you can easily access the mini statement through the IPPB Mobile App. On the other hand, if you use a net banking service, you can access the account statement you received via mail.
The PDF statement will be password-protected, so you must enter the password to open it. Once you open the statement, you will see your account details at the top of the page. Your Customer ID will be listed right below the account number. You can find your IPPB CIF number in the monthly account statement.
When you open a new IPPB account, you will receive a welcome kit that contains all your account details. The kit contains a document that includes the Customer ID of IPPB along with other relevant information.
